It is said to be "the count of the feudal lord, Tadamasa Sakai", and only the "Monument to honor Colonel Nakamura" was dug in front, and there was no side monument. When I turned to the back, the origin was written in Chinese style, and it looked like a monument to honor erected in 1945.
After seeing the slope of the fan, there was a large stone monument suddenly on the way to Nishinomaru. I didn't bother to see it to the back, but there was no explanation.
It was engraved with the former feudal lord and count Tadamasa Sakai. As the title suggests, he stood in the castle of Himeji Castle at the time of the honorary monument of Colonel Shigeto Nakamura of the Army. It was like a monument to honor the contribution to the survival of Himeji Castle.
